○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 S-Seek Function—Memory Button You can store the current Program Definition Text (PDT: Artist Name and Song title) with a total of 30 Artist/Song Title combinations, then by using the stored information, you can make your JVC PnP search the current incoming Sirius signal and alert you when a saved song is being played—S-Seek function.

○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 0 Time Based Features The following adjustments are possible on this submenu screen— • Clock • Alarm Clock • Program Alert • Auto Shutdown • Sleep Mode Clock When entering this menu option, you can set up the clock shown on the display. The clock data is provided via the SIRIUS Satellite stream, and will be updated automatically.
○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 ○ Alarm Clock Program Alert You can set your JVC PnP to turn on at a specific time. The last selected stream prior to shutdown will be played when the Alarm turns on your JVC PnP. You can program your JVC PnP to switch to a specified stream at a specified time. • To use your programmed setting, make sure to set “Program Alert” to “Program Alert On”.
